1. AUrate

AUrate is all about sustainable, ethically-sourced fine jewelry that looks great and does good. Using recycled 14k and 18k gold, their pieces feel delicate and timeless, perfect for everyday wear. Think dainty stacking rings, simple gold hoops, and classic necklaces that are designed to last a lifetime.

Their designs share Mejuri's minimalist aesthetic, but with an even stronger focus on transparent sourcing and lifelong quality. Prices for their gold vermeil collection are similar, often ranging from $50-$200, making them a fantastic alternative for conscious shoppers who want beautiful essentials.

2. Catbird

Based in Brooklyn, Catbird is the cool, slightly whimsical friend you've been searching for. Famous for their ultra-dainty, barely-there rings and unique, poetic charms, their pieces have an artisan-made feel. They use recycled gold and ethically sourced stones, and their collection is perfect for creating a personalized and layered look.

While Mejuri’s vibe is more sleek and modern, Catbird offers a touch of boho magic and handcrafted charm. If you love Mejuri's stackable philosophy but want pieces with more character and a story, Catbird is your go-to.

3. Missoma

Missoma is the brand you see all over your favorite fashion influencer's feed, and for good reason. They are masters of layering, offering trendy-yet-timeless gold chain necklaces, signature hoops, and stackable rings that instantly elevate any look. Their pieces often feel a bit bolder than Mejuri's, embracing statement pendants and chunky chains alongside their more delicate offerings.

Price points are quite similar, usually from $50 to $200. Missoma is perfect if you love the quality of Mejuri but want styles that are more on-trend and make a slightly bigger impact. Their collaboration collections are always a sell-out hit.

4. Ana Luisa

Ana Luisa delivers carbon-neutral, beautifully crafted jewelry without the luxury markup. Their style leans heavily into modern minimalism, featuring everything from dainty huggie hoops to elegant chain necklaces and stackable rings. Their designs are clean, versatile, and made from eco-conscious materials, which is a major win.

With pieces starting around $39, they're one of the most budget-friendly alternatives to Mejuri, without compromising on quality or aesthetics. If you appreciate Mejuri’s direct-to-consumer model and clean look but want it at an even more accessible price point, Ana Luisa is a perfect match.

5. Kinn

Kinn focuses on creating modern heirlooms - fine jewelry made from solid 14k gold designed to be passed down through generations. Their collection is full of timeless pieces with a slightly vintage-inspired, sculptural feel, from classic dome rings to herringbone chain necklaces. They champion quality craftsmanship that is meant to last forever.

While their price point is higher than Mejuri's, the investment goes into solid gold pieces rather than gold vermeil or plated options. For those who are ready to level up their collection with solid gold essentials that still feel modern and cool, Kinn is the next step.

8. Vrai

Vrai is where sustainability meets luxury. They specialize in beautifully minimalist pieces featuring lab-grown diamonds set in recycled solid gold. Their entire process, from growing the diamonds to crafting the jewelry, is managed in-house to reduce environmental impact. Think timeless diamond studs, solitaire necklaces, and whisper-thin stacking rings.

While Vrai is a higher investment, it shares Mejuri's commitment to transparency and modern design. It's the ideal choice for anyone looking for their first piece of diamond jewelry that is both ethical and elegantly understated.

19. The DAURA Shop

The DAURA Shop offers a curated collection of waterproof, tarnish-resistant jewelry made from 18k gold plated stainless steel. Their style feels both classic and totally modern, specializing in herringbone chains, croissant rings, and simple dome huggie hoops that look way more expensive than they are.

With most pieces under $60, it's the perfect brand for anyone who wants that perfect everyday gold that can withstand an active lifestyle. If durability is your top priority in the search for your daily favorites, check them out.
